主题中讨论的其他器件:CC2640
大家好、
是否可以设置优先级高于 BLE 堆栈的硬件中断? 我的同事对低延迟中断感兴趣。 我在这里找到了一些对它的引用: e2e.ti.com/.../527148 中断蓝牙 TI RTOS、但该线程似乎未被解析。
任何有关硬件中断延迟可能是多少的数据?
谢谢、
不需要
This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
大家好、
是否可以设置优先级高于 BLE 堆栈的硬件中断? 我的同事对低延迟中断感兴趣。 我在这里找到了一些对它的引用: e2e.ti.com/.../527148 中断蓝牙 TI RTOS、但该线程似乎未被解析。
任何有关硬件中断延迟可能是多少的数据?
谢谢、
不需要
所有测试都是使用默认的中断优先级组完成的。
您可以更改优先级组、但使用优先级组的风险与所有创建/构建的 Hwi 对象相同(例如、一般规则是 Hwi 对象执行时间应尽可能短、以便进行中断后处理)。 要更改优先级组、请参阅 http://processors.wiki.ti.com/index.php/SYS/BIOS_for_Stellaris_Devices#Supported_Priority_Values
如果要使用零延迟中断、则不得使用该中断中的任何内核 API。 虽然速度非常快、但不能使用诸如 Semaphore_post ()、Event_post ()等 API。。。 http://processors.wiki.ti.com/index.php/SYS/BIOS_for_Stellaris_Devices#Zero_Latency_Interrupt_Support
内核的发行说明具有"基准测试"链接、可回答您的硬件延迟中断问题。
此致、
Tom